Based on the latest financial reports, Murapol S.A. (MUR) has total liabilities worth zł1.79 Billion PLN (≈ $493.37 Million USD) as of December 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Annual Total Liabilities for Murapol S.A. (2017–2025)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Murapol S.A. from 2017 to 2025.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2025-09-30 zł1.79 Billion
≈ $493.37 Million
+15.11%
2024-09-30 zł1.56 Billion
≈ $428.59 Million
+19.75%
2023-09-30 zł1.30 Billion
≈ $357.90 Million
+0.80%
2022-09-30 zł1.29 Billion
≈ $355.05 Million
+15.56%
2021-09-30 zł1.12 Billion
≈ $307.24 Million
+16.74%
2020-09-30 zł956.28 Million
≈ $263.18 Million
-28.35%
2019-09-30 zł1.33 Billion
≈ $367.30 Million
-0.71%
2018-09-30 zł1.34 Billion
≈ $369.92 Million
+9.55%
2017-09-30 zł1.23 Billion
≈ $337.66 Million
--
